Ajman
Mufaddal Raj Bldg Material Trdg LLC
cable suppliers
Grand Crest Interior Decoration LLC, Churchill Executive Towers 3812 Dubai United Arab Emirates
zia creative network, M01 New Al Kaabi Bldg Delma Street Abu Dhabi United Arab Emirates
Al Wasl Pack, 9FJ8JMC Ajman Industrial 2 Ajman United Arab Emirates
Super General Service Center, Emirates Industrial City Dubai United Arab Emirates
Mufaddal Raj Bldg Material Trdg LLC, Unnamed Road
+97167410067